Fix the special case of multiple features being exactly on a lat or lon line, by adding minimal buffer to the identical lat or lon value right before doing the catalogue query.

Generally I am confused about the difference in:

if len(shapely_geometries) == 1 and isinstance(shapely_geometries[0], Point):

and the else condition.

The else condition is here constructed to accommodate polygons which are actually points.

Would it not be better then the homogenize this by doing something alike:

 if isinstance(geometry, Point) or (
            isinstance(geometry, (Polygon, MultiPolygon)) and geometry.area == 0
        ):
            geometry = geometry.buffer(0.0001)  # Buffer to create a tiny area

This is some pseudo code, where the point buffer case would be made homogeneous

if bounds[0] == bounds[2]:
bounds = (bounds[0], bounds[1], bounds[2] + 0.0001, bounds[3])
if bounds[1] == bounds[3]:
bounds = (bounds[0], bounds[1], bounds[2], bounds[3] + 0.0001)

You can avoid some code duplication here by:

# Ensure min/max are not identical
    min_x, min_y, max_x, max_y = bounds
    if min_x == max_x:
        max_x += 0.0001
    if min_y == max_y:
        max_y += 0.0001
